Equivalent Units of Production: Average Cost Method
The Converting Department of Tender Soft Tissue Company uses the average cost method and had 1,900 units in work in process that were 60% complete at the beginning of the period. During the period, 15,800 units were completed and transferred to the Packing Department. There were 1,200 units in process that were 30% complete at the end of the period.
a. Determine the number of whole units to be accounted for and to be assigned costs for the period.
units
b. Determine the number of equivalent units of production for the period.

Explanation / Answer
a) the number of whole units to be accounted for and to be assigned costs for the period
= units completed and transferred to the Packing Department + Ending WIP
= 15800 + 1200
= 17000 units.
b)
